Thank you so much for making all these videos. My husband and I are looking into getting Chinchillas. In regard to cleaning, is it OK to use bleach wipes to clean the shelves and hideaway homes? Or can you only use soapy water? What chemicals are not harmful to chinchillas?
rissa8592 5 days ago
@rissa8592 Chinchillas are sensitive to chemicals , they are delicate ..yet hardy animals.
Please save your time and money and not take a chance on chemicals.
a 50/50 mix ...white vinegar and water is all you need ...and you'll spend a dollar or two.
Soapy water for sure is not good. There are bottles of things like CLEAN CAGE that you can use if you want to spend 12 -16 dollars.
I use a Dirt Devil easy steam handheld for most of the cleaning these days...no chemicals, whatsoevr.

i'm considering getting a chinchilla and at night i sleep with my fan on high, and i was wondering would that disturb the chinchilla or could i just put a towel on the top of their cage or what?
seaweed464 8 months ago
@seaweed464 the fan will not disturb the chinchilla what will disturb and perhaps even kill the chinchilla is no air conditioning (you didnt say that...just alerting you) Fans , swamp coolers etc are NOT suitable for chinchillas they do not sweat , and can not bear temps above 75 F or humidity above 40-5o percent. Also ... a chinchilla gets into EVERYTHING... a fan anywhere near a chinchilla, the AC cord, the fan itself poses a danger to an animal that doesnt understand.

gurglefiction 10 months ago
@gurglefiction they need fresh hay 24 hours a day prefarably Timothy...but orchard, and other hays are good, in fact we switch them to different hays often , as its good for their teeth. Alfalfa is just for young chinchillas , up to 6 months or so. it contains too much calcium. They should have good pellets like Oxbow or Mazuri
each day, about 1/4 to 1/2 a cup. Refill if they finish. No treat food,,.,like charlie chinchilla
